Quellcode durchsuchen

added isInteger helper

Alexander Rose vor 5 Jahren
Ursprung
Commit
f2de2983c8
1 geänderte Dateien mit 6 neuen und 0 gelöschten Zeilen
  1. 6 0
      src/mol-util/number.ts

+ 6 - 0
src/mol-util/number.ts

@@ -46,4 +46,10 @@ export function getArrayDigitCount(xs: ArrayLike<number>, maxDigits: number, del
         }
     }
     return { mantissaDigits, integerDigits };
+}
+
+export function isInteger(s: string) {
+    s = s.trim()
+    const n = parseInt(s, 10)
+    return isNaN(n) ? false : n.toString() === s
 }